Sounds like you have a electrical gremlin, as you probably already suspected (comment about grabbing the multi-meter).
Has it ever failed when trying to put the shield down? If not, then you may be able to narrow the search to the relays (either could be at fault), the handle bar switch, and the wires between them. Gently tugging on the wires while trying the switch could induce the failure, if it's a bad wire or connection.
Otherwise, you might want to poke around the fuse boxes under the seat, and gently tug on the wires around the windshield fuse (box 3, fuse 4). Also take a close look at the fuse itself.
Next time it's in the fail mode, tap gently but firmly on the relays while pushing the button to test. If it suddenly starts working, you might just have a bad relay.
If it only fails in one direction, you can pretty much rule out the motor, as it's only two wires, and the relays change the polarity to the motor.
